Just How Solar Panels Generate Electricity
Solar panels harness the sunlight's energy by transforming sunshine right into power via a process referred to as the solar result. When sunshine strikes the solar panels, the photons (light bits) are taken in by the semiconducting products within the panels, usually constructed from silicon. This absorption generates an electrical present as the photons knock electrons loosened from the atoms within the material.
The electric areas within the solar cells then force these electrons to stream in a specific direction, developing a direct current (DC) of power. This direct current is after that travelled through an inverter, which transforms it right into alternating current (AIR CONDITIONING) electrical power that can be utilized to power your home or business.
Excess electrical energy produced by the solar panels can be saved in batteries for later usage or fed back into the grid for credit history via a process called web metering. Comprehending Photovoltaic Panel Parts
One vital element of photovoltaic panel modern technology is comprehending the various elements that make up a photovoltaic panel system.
The key components of a solar panel system consist of the photovoltaic panels themselves, which are composed of photovoltaic cells that convert sunshine right into power. These panels are placed on a structure, commonly a roofing, to catch sunlight.
In addition to the panels, there are inverters that transform the direct current (DC) electrical power generated by the panels into alternating current (A/C) power that can be used in homes or companies.
The system also consists of racking to support and position the solar panels for optimum sunlight direct exposure. In addition, cables and ports are important for carrying the electrical power created by the panels to the electrical system of a building.
Finally, a monitoring system may be consisted of to track the efficiency of the photovoltaic panel system and guarantee it's functioning efficiently. Recognizing these parts is important for any individual aiming to install or utilize photovoltaic panel innovation efficiently.
